Why Substance Abuse?

Growing Field

Federal funding for addiction treatment has increased dramatically, creating new positions nationwide.

Diverse Settings

Work in detox centers, residential rehab, outpatient clinics, or integrated primary care settings.

Loan Forgiveness

Many SUD treatment positions qualify for Public Service Loan Forgiveness and NHSC programs.

What qualifications do I need for substance abuse PMHNP jobs?

To work as a PMHNP in Somersworth, you need: a Master's or Doctoral degree in psychiatric-mental health nursing, ANCC PMHNP-BC certification, an active RN and APRN license in New Hampshire, and DEA registration for prescribing controlled substances.
